1. Green Pipes: Prince Pipes’ Green Pipes are a testament to the company’s commitment to sustainability. Made from recycled PVC, these pipes offer an eco-friendly alternative to traditional PVC pipes. By using recycled materials, Green Pipes reduce waste, minimize environmental impact, and support the circular economy.

The science behind Green Pipes lies in their unique manufacturing process, which involves using recycled PVC powder generated from post-consumer PVC waste. This waste is collected, sorted, and processed to produce high-quality PVC powder that can be used to manufacture pipes. The use of recycled PVC reduces the environmental footprint of the production process, minimizing the need for virgin PVC and the resulting waste generated during production.
